Representation can refer to:
- Representation (politics), one's ability to influence the political process
- Representative democracy
- (Permanent) Representation, a type of Diplomatic mission
- Representation of the International NGO - the representative office of the INGO mission
- Representation (arts), the depiction and ethical concerns of construction in visual arts and literature.
- Depiction is meaning conveyed through pictures
- Representation (psychology), a hypothetical 'internal' cognitive symbol that represents external reality
- Representation (mathematics)
- Multiple representations (mathematics education)
- Representation (chemistry)
- Representation (systemics)
- Knowledge representation, the study of formal ways to describe knowledge
- Legal representation or advocacy is provided by lawyers
- Lobbying for a group of individuals or companies
- In unionised workplaces, shop stewards and union executives can represent employees
- The legal status of a statement made with regards to Contract Law
